Hochsteg

Art Appreciation

The artwork captures a rugged, untamed landscape, dominated by a rushing waterfall cascading through a rocky gorge. The artist's skillful use of tonal variations creates a sense of depth and texture, making the rocks appear solid and the water dynamic. The composition leads the eye upwards, past the cascading water, towards a wooden bridge, and into a more subdued, shadowed area, suggesting a path into the unknown. The limited palette of browns and whites evokes a sense of nostalgia, perhaps a memory of a specific place or a longing for a simpler time.
